It's rare that a small startup is able to challenge the likes of Facebook and Snapchat in a meaningful way.
But Houseparty, a teen-centric video chat app is managing to do just that. One year since launching publicly (the company spent several months in a stealthy beta), Houseparty has grown to 20 million users who together have participated in more than half a billion video calls (or "parties," to use the app's terminology).
Twenty million may sound like a drop in the bucket compared to Facebook's billions or even Snapchat's 166 million users.
